________________ SOLANKI PERIOD 337 Assuming that the year given in the Girnar Inscrip-. tion dated Sañ. 58, belongs to the Simha era, Kielhorn finds that the Simha year commenced with Aşādha rather than Caitra38. But as established above, the date of this inscription applies not to the Simha era but to the Vikrama era, the figures of the hundreds being left understood. As regards the years of the Simha era, the equations between the Simha years and the corresponding Valabhī and Vikrama years in all the four known dates may be examined anew. The equations between the Simha years and the corresponding Valabhī years are as follows : year 795 Month Simha Vikrama Difference year 60 855 Āsādha 151 945 794 From this it follows that the difference is 794 in Aşādha and 795 in some other months. This makes it clear that the Simha year could not be Kārttikādi for otherwise it would yield a uniform difference in relation 10 the corresponding Valabhī year which was invariably Kārttikādi39. 38. Kielhorn, IA., Vol. XXII, p. 109 Shri G. H. Ojha (BPL., p. 184) and Shri D. C. Sircar (1E, p. 305), too, hold that the year of the Simba Era commenced with Āşādha, śu. di. 1. They cite no authority for it, but that seems to have been based on that of Kielhorn. 39.
